Ghana forward Kwabena Owusu leaves Turkish club Ankaragucu

Published on: 08 June 2022

Ghana forward Kwabena Owusu has left Turkish second tier side Ankaragucu at the end of his loan spell. 

The former Ghana U23 striker had a good campaign in the Turkey with Ankaragucu but returns to parent club Qarabag ahead of next season.

Owusu scored seven goals in 21 matches and was hoping to extend his stay in Turkey.

However, Ankaragucu are reported to have parted ways with the forward due to the price placed on him by the Azerbaijani giants.

Meanwhile, information reach GHANASoccernet.com reveals Qarabag will want to cash in on the player with a year left on his contract.

Some topflight clubs in Turkey are eyeing a move for the striker in the summer transfer window.

Kwabena Owusu was a member of Ghana's Black Stars at the 2019 Africa Cup of Nations in Egypt.
